Syndopa 110 is a combination medicine that contains Levodopa and Carbidopa. It is designed to manage dopamine levels in the brain, which play a key role in motor control and coordination. This tablet is often recommended as a part of neurological health support to improve the signs of Parkinsonism.
Levodopa converts to dopamine in the brain, while Carbidopa helps reduce the breakdown of Levodopa before it reaches the brain. This dual action supports more efficient dopamine availability and may assist in improving movement-related functions.
SYNDOPA 110 TABLET is not recommended for use in women who are pregnant or breastfeeding, including children and adolescents (aged below 18 years).
It is important for caregivers to notice and report doctor immediately that if the patient develops any addictive symptoms like craving for large doses of SYNDOPA 110, unusual behaviour, gambling, excessive eating or spending, an abnormally high sex drive or any other activities that could harm themselves or others.
Try to avoid eating a heavy meal that includes a lot of protein (such as beef, pork, cheese, fish and eggs) while taking SYNDOPA 110, as it may interfere with its absorption.
The common side effects of taking SYNDOPA 110 TABLET are nausea, vomiting, abnormal muscle movements, loss of appetite, dry mouth, bitter taste and tiredness. Consult your doctor if any of the side effects worsen.
